Water Heater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Water leak under 10 square feet | Yes | No | DIY kits are available and effective for small leaks. |
| Water leak affecting entire floor or multiple levels | No | Yes | Professionals have the equipment and expertise to handle large-scale water damage. |
| Water leak causing structural damage | No | Yes | Structural damage needs specialized techniques and equipment to repair safely and effectively. |

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ost In Mount Vernon, MO
The cost of Water Heater Leak Water Removal in Mount Vernon, MO can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Estimates range from $500 to $2,500 depending on the specific needs of your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, water temperature, and equipment usage |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ment usage, and duration of service |

Common Questions About Water Heater Leak Water Removal
Q: What causes water heater leaks?
A: Water heater leaks are often caused by corrosion, worn-out parts, or improper installation. Regular maintenance can help prevent these issues.
Q: Is water damage covered by insurance?
A: Yes, water damage is usually covered by homeowners’ insurance policies. But, it’s essential to review your policy and contact your insurance provider for specific details.
Q: How long does it take to dry a property after water damage?
A: Drying time varies depending on the size of the affected area, equipment usage, and local conditions. Our team works efficiently to reduce disruption and secondary damage.
Q: Can I prevent water damage from happening in the first place?
A: Yes, regular maintenance, inspections, and addressing issues quickly can help prevent water damage. We recommend scheduling regular water heater inspections with our team.
